Job summary
A construction materials company in Wisconsin is seeking a Utility Worker to support concrete plant operations. The role includes operating equipment, loading aggregate, and assisting in daily maintenance tasks. Ideal candidates should have a high school diploma, valid driver's license, and the ability to lift 50 lbs. The position offers competitive pay, employer-paid medical benefits, and opportunities for career growth within the company.
Qualifications
Valid Driver's License and satisfactory driving record.
Able to lift 50 lbs.
Demonstrated ability to follow instructions and communicate effectively.
Responsibilities
Load concrete plant aggregate bins for production.
Operate equipment such as loader and forklift.
Assist customers with product purchases.
Complete daily truck maintenance and inspections.
Participate in safety training and report unsafe conditions.
